Song meaning of The Syringe Dance by Zhrine

Artist:Zhrine     January 22,2024
The song "The Syringe Dance" by Zhrine presents a vivid portrayal of a society immersed in a state of madness. The lyrics suggest that this madness infects everyone, pushing them towards a constant yearning for artificial and temporary pleasures. It entices individuals with promises of comfort, wealth, and ignorance, keeping them blindfolded to the crumbling world around them.

Amidst this chaos, the song highlights the degradation of morals and intelligence. Virtue and wisdom are depicted as withering to dust, implying a loss of values and the erosion of critical thinking. The lyrics hint at a time when these qualities were boundless and abundant, suggesting that their absence is now keenly felt.

The final lines of the song further emphasize the deterioration of the natural world. The imagery of fruits bearing no seeds and the earth yielding no fruit symbolizes a barren and fruitless existence. This could be interpreted as a consequence of humanity's relentless pursuit of instant gratification and ignorance, causing irreparable damage to the environment.

Overall, the song "The Syringe Dance" seems to convey a cautionary message about the dangers of succumbing to a society driven by materialism and distraction. It urges listeners to question the allure of immediate gratification and to consider the consequences of disregarding deeper values and the natural world.
